>>232931
>reterutsusuyo
You can't just do that. That would be like looking at the word "guessing", and going "Well, I don't know what 'guess' means, but ING is an insurance company, so it's clearly talking about insurance somehow".
Also, that's a っ, not a つ.
>>232931
>plus a kanji I don't know
It's 忘れる. It's a contraction of わすれているです.

I'm trying to set up a class that receives a date and if it's not a valid date sets it to 1/1/2000 (among other things it does)
So let's say this is how I check if it's valid
[code]private static int numDaysInMonth(int month, boolean isLeapYear)
{
switch (month)
{
case 1:
case 3:
case 5:
case 7:
case 8:
case 10:
case 12:
return 31;
case 4:
case 6:
case 9:
case 11:
return 30;
case 2:
if (isLeapYear)
{
return 29;
} else
{
return 28;
}
default:
return 0;
}
}
public static boolean isLeapYear(int year)
{
return (((year % 4 == 0) && !(year % 100 == 0)) || (year % 400 == 0));
}
public static boolean isValidDate(int month, int day, int year)
{
return (month >= 1 && month <= 12) && (day >= 1 && day <= numDaysInMonth(month, isLeapYear(year))) && (year >= 0 && year <= maxYear);
}[/code]
And these are my constructors for the Date object
[code]public Date(int day, int month, int year)
{
_day = day;
_month = month;
_year = year;
}
// Additional constructor
public Date(Date date)
{
_day = date._day
_month = date._month
_year = date._year
}[/code]
How do I "fuse" them so that every date I receive is checked to be valid and reset to 1/1/2000 if not, as a private method within the same class?

>>232724
There aren't any samples. It's generated algorithmically.
Except for Vocaloid which is a mix of both techniques.
